How Smart Contracts Are Improving the Security of Online Payments
In today’s digital landscape, security breaches and fraudulent activities pose significant threats to online transactions. However, smart contracts are rapidly transforming the way online payments are processed, offering enhanced security and efficiency. Utilizing blockchain technology, smart contracts are self-executing contracts with the terms of the agreement directly written into code, ensuring transparency and reliability.
One of the primary advantages of smart contracts is their decentralized nature. Traditional payment systems often rely on central authorities to validate transactions, which can become points of failure. With smart contracts, transactions are recorded on a blockchain, making manipulation or unauthorized access nearly impossible. This decentralized structure enhances the authenticity and security of online payments.
Additionally, smart contracts eliminate the need for intermediaries, such as banks or payment processors, which are often vulnerable to hacks and fraud. By automating the payment process through code, these contracts facilitate direct transactions between buyers and sellers. This reduction in third-party involvement not only speeds up the payment process but also minimizes the risk of human error and fraud.
Furthermore, smart contracts provide an immutable audit trail. Each transaction is permanently recorded on the blockchain and can be easily verified by all parties involved. This transparency allows users to trace the history of payments, enhancing accountability and confidence among stakeholders. Businesses can monitor transactions in real-time, identifying any discrepancies or fraudulent activities swiftly.
Security measures embedded within the smart contracts themselves also contribute to overall safety. Developers can program conditions that must be met before a transaction is executed, reducing the chances of unauthorized payments. For example, a smart contract can be programmed to release funds only when certain conditions, like the delivery of goods, are confirmed. This feature not only ensures compliance but also instills trust among users.
Moreover, smart contracts utilize advanced cryptographic techniques, such as public-private key encryption, to secure transaction data. This encryption ensures that only parties with the correct keys can access the information, safeguarding sensitive financial data from cyber threats and unauthorized access.
